Mathematical wit and mathematical cognition

This study analyzes a mathematical joke to reveal hidden cognitive processes in scientific discovery. Humor in mathematics is linked to risky, creative reasoning essential for innovation.
Area of Science:
- Cognitive Science
- Philosophy of Mathematics
- Mathematical Practice
Background:
- Scientific publications often obscure the cognitive processes behind discoveries.
- Understanding mathematical practice requires examining less obvious sources.
Purpose of the Study:
- To analyze a mathematical joke as a source for understanding cognitive processes in mathematics.
- To propose an account of mathematical humor using argumentation schemes.
Main Methods:
- Analysis of a mathematical joke featuring spurious proof types.
- Application of argumentation schemes to explicate joke components.
- Classification of reasoning patterns under seven headings: retroduction, citation, intuition, meta-argument, closure, generalization, and definition.
Main Results:
- Mathematical humor is associated with risky inferences crucial for creative mathematics.
- Argumentation schemes provide a framework for analyzing topic-neutral reasoning in jokes.
- The joke's components were explicated using devised argumentation schemes.
Conclusions:
- Analyzing humor offers insights into the cognitive underpinnings of mathematical creativity.
- Argumentation schemes are valuable tools for studying mathematical practice and cognition.
- This approach has broader implications for the cognitive science of mathematics.
